How Commercial Financing Works for Alexandria Businesses

Commercial financing is a broad category encompassing several loan types, each suited to different business needs and timeline horizons.

Term Loans for Working Capital and Growth

A term loan provides a lump sum upfront, which you repay over a fixed period—typically three to ten years, though terms vary by lender and loan structure. This works well for professional services firms hiring new staff, government contractors purchasing equipment or technology, or any business needing capital to fund expansion. The fixed repayment schedule makes budgeting predictable.

Lines of Credit

Some Alexandria businesses prefer a revolving line of credit—you borrow what you need, repay it, and can borrow again up to your limit. This structure suits consulting firms with uneven cash flow or government contractors managing the timing gaps between invoicing and payment.

Asset-Based and Equipment Financing

If you’re financing specific equipment or real estate, lenders often structure loans around those assets. For instance, a professional services firm opening a new office in Alexandria might explore commercial real estate financing, while a government contractor purchasing specialized equipment might turn to equipment financing. These structures often result in better terms because the asset serves as collateral.

Understanding Virginia’s Commercial Finance Transparency Standards

Virginia’s commercial finance disclosure laws are an advantage to borrowers. Lenders must provide standardized cost disclosures, meaning you’ll see the total cost of borrowing broken down clearly. This transparency helps you compare options across lenders and understand exactly what you’re paying for. When you’re evaluating financing offers, insist on these disclosures—they’re your right as a Virginia business owner, and they make side-by-side comparison straightforward.

Frequently Asked Questions

What financing terms can I typically expect as a government contractor in Alexandria?

Terms vary widely by lender, your credit profile, and deal structure. Government contractors in Alexandria often secure favorable terms because their contracts provide revenue visibility and credit strength. Lenders typically consider contract value, the stability of your client base, and your track record when setting terms. Term lengths often range from three to seven years for working capital loans, though requirements vary by lender. The best approach is to speak directly with lenders experienced in government contracting—they’ll assess your specific situation and discuss realistic options.

Can I use commercial financing to open a new office location in Alexandria?

Yes. If you’re purchasing or leasing real estate, commercial real estate financing is a primary tool. If you’re leasing and need capital for buildout, equipment, or working capital tied to the expansion, a term loan or line of credit may be more appropriate. Lenders typically structure these loans based on the asset, your cash flow, and your ability to service the debt.
